Increase the Value of Your Home
Vinyl windows are listed among the top five home improvement projects with a documented return on investment. According to the 2022 Cost Vs. Value Report from Remodeling Magazine, homeowners can recover over two-thirds of the installation expenses, boosting their home’s worth by an average of more than $13,000.
Specialty Shapes
Fixed, non-opening windows in circular, arched and linear shapes.
Awning Window
Hinged at the top, sash cranks out and up with a turn of the handle.
Bow Windows
Combination window that adds interior space and exterior dimension.
Casem*nt Window
Hinged on the side, sash cranks open outward to the left or right.
Double Hung Window
Both bottom and top sash open and tilt in for easy in-home cleaning.
Sliding Window
Sash slides to open and close horizontally left or right.
Picture Window
Fixed non-opening window can be used in large or small areas.
Single Hung Window
Fixed top sash with a bottom sash that lifts open and tilts in.

Frequently Asked Questions
Why are Vinyl Windows a Popular Option?
Vinyl windows gained popularity due to their ease of maintenance, cost-effectiveness, and simpler cleaning requirements in contrast to wood or aluminum windows.
How Common are Vinyl Windows?
In earlier times, the predominant window materials were wood and aluminum-clad wood, whereas today, vinyl windows have emerged as the preferred and most widely used option due to their durability and maintenance.
Are Vinyl Windows Cost-Effective and Low Maintenance?
Vinyl windows contribute to preserving indoor warmth in winter and blocking excess heat during hot and humid summer periods, resulting in reduced reliance on climate control systems. This translates to cost savings on your utility expenses.
